About This Item
London: Dawsons of Pall Mall. Near Fine. 1973. Reprint of the 1907 edition.. Hardcover. 0712905863 . Spine just a trifle sunned otherwise fine. ; Near fine red cloth hard back with gilt decoration. No inscriptions or marks. Covers the religious houses of Sussex. It includes an account of Chichester cathedral. Other topics include local industries, schools, hunts and sports. ; The Victoria History of the Counties of England; Vol. 2; Black & White Photographs and drawings; 4to 11" - 13" tall; xv, 481 pages .
